What is remote gaming customer support?

Remote gaming customer support refers to professionals who assist players of video games or online gaming platforms with issues, questions, or technical problems, all while working from a remote location. Their duties may include troubleshooting game bugs, helping with account issues, answering gameplay questions, and providing guidance on in-game purchases. They typically communicate with customers via live chat, email, or phone, and are expected to have strong knowledge of the games and platforms they support. Working remotely allows these support agents to assist gamers from anywhere, often across different time zones. This role helps gaming companies maintain positive player experiences and resolve issues ef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Gaming Customer Support representative,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Gaming Customer Support representative, you need strong problem-solving abilities, excellent written and verbal communication skills, and a thorough understanding of gaming platforms or products. Familiarity with customer support ticketing systems (like Zendesk or Freshdesk), live chat tools, and basic troubleshooting protocols is typically required. Outstanding patience, empathy, and the ability to remain calm under pressure help you build rapport and resolve customer issues effectively. These skills ensure players receive timely, accurate assistance, fostering positive user experiences and customer loyalty.

What are some typical challenges faced by Remote Gaming Customer Support representatives, and how can they be managed effectively?

Remote Gaming Customer Support representatives often encounter challenges such as handling high volumes of support requests during peak times, addressing technical issues across multiple gaming platforms, and maintaining clear communication despite language or cultural differences. To manage these effectively, it's important to stay organized, make use of comprehensive knowledge bases, and communicate professionally and empathetically with players. Regular training and collaboration with technical teams can also help resolve complex issues more efficiently and keep you updated on new game features or policies.

Pratt & Whitney has a long history of leadership and innovation in the field of aviation propulsion. Our story begins in the 1920s and has flourished throughout the decades. We have continuously transformed and reinvented our businesses to offer superior products and services to our customers. In 1925, the Pratt & Whitney Aircraft Company was founded by Frederick B. Rentschler, pioneer of the air-cooled radial engine design which enabled unprecedented power-to-weight ratio. Its first engine, the R-1340 Wasp engine, transformed military and commercial aviation and is still in use today. In 1928, the Canadian division of the Pratt & Whitney Aircraft Company was established. In 1944, Pratt & Whitney began its gas turbine and jet propulsion initiative. The company constructed a wind tunnel, laboratory and engineering center to support our allies’ efforts in World War II. In 1945, wartime production included more than 300,000 Pratt & Whitney engines, touted by service members as extremely dependable – a legacy that continues today. From there, Pratt & Whitney continued to design and innovate more powerful, agile, and reliable engines becoming a leader in the aerospace industry. Today, Pratt & Whitney has more than 85,000 engines in service and more than 16,000 customers worldwide.
